1、Arrays.asList可以转换为集合吗?
可以看到ArrayList是Arrays内部类,并不是常用的ArrayList类
public class Arrays {
...
private static class ArrayList<E> extends AbstractList<E>
implements RandomAccess, java.io.Serializable
{
private static final long serialVersionUID = -2764017481108945198L;
private final E[] a;
ArrayList(E[] array) {
a = Objects.

本文介绍了如何将整数数组转换为Java集合,重点讨论了Arrays.asList的使用、流式转换、包装类型声明以及ArrayList的内部结构。同时探讨了如何避免ArrayList的不可变性问题,以及类似SubList的视图操作技巧。
最低0.47元/天 解锁文章
1191

被折叠的 条评论
为什么被折叠?



